Silver, gold plated, 19k gold, what’s the difference?

Every material has its particularities:

925 Silver is a precious metal that doesn’t lose its shine if you take good care of it! Of course, these jewels can be worn on a day to day basis without harming them but you need to know how to take care of them when they are not being worn.

Vermeil jewels are made out of 925 silver, adorned with several layers of gold. They have the same appearance as solid gold jewelry, but are much less expensive. It is therefore necessary to take care of them, so that the gold layer does not fade away quickly. 

18 and 19 carats gold are the most noble. They are of great quality and last for years. They are made of 75% gold and 25% other materials to make them strong (because 24k gold is malleable). These jewels are easy to care of and are never in danger of losing their color.

So, how do I take care of my jewels?

Remember to keep them away from direct light and humidity. A small closed box in a sock drawer in your room is a perfect place to store them! 

If you notice that your jewels are starting to lose their shine, wipe them gently with a chamois cloth. Don’t hesitate to ask for them for free when you order online or while you’re at our Showroom!

For jewelry, especially the gold plated ones, we highly discourage you to put any kind of creams or perfumes on them. These products can have some chemicals that can damage your prettiest treasures. Don’t worry about fresh water though!

Jewels made out of 925 silver can sometimes lose their shine if they are not well isolated. Here are some solutions:

For a silver jewelry that has been oxidized, a product that works wonders is the Silver Clean. Careful with it because you don’t want to use to much of it. We personally use the one from the brand Hagerty that can be bought at Di. You just need to dip your jewel in the product for a few seconds, rince the product off and gently wipe the excess water and ta-daa!
